Mechadusto
Devon
United States
Currently Offline
Favorite Game
2,530
Hours played
416
Achievements
Recent Activity
586 hrs on record
last played on 30 Aug
1,007 hrs on record
last played on 28 Aug
4 hrs on record
last played on 24 Aug
Comments
PlayingDead 23 May, 2024 @ 7:03pm 
hrrmmm
Mr. Negativity 4 Mar, 2015 @ 11:00pm 
Rekt